Professional camper van conversions

There are a number of companies offering professional camper van conversions. These companies are specialists and deliver excellent work. Most will convert any vehicle you provide them, and most will source a new or used base vehicle for you. A lot of these companies also provide parts, and complete kits for your own camper van conversion.

If you are thinking of building your own camper van the images on these websites are good for ideas.

  7. lpg regulations
    Hi My husband has converted a van for us and I have to say he has done an excellent job. We are now only finishing by plumbing in the gas, we have a oven, hob, grill and fire. Connections are 6mm can anyone advise on regulations re whether pipe has to be copper( pvc covered) or if the flexi hose which is also used for LPG car fuel conversions would also be suitable. I cannot find anything anywhere as to what you HAVE to have. Thanks

    Reply

    1. Hi Irene
      As far as I know,

      Hi Irene

      As far as I know, you do not have to comply with any regulations, unless you intend to rent out the vehicle. You can read that in this document:
      http://www.hse.gov.uk/foi/internalops/fod/oc/400-499/440_34.pdf

      Standard practice is to use copper pipe to all appliances. Flexible hose should only be used from the gas bottle regulator to a manifold. From the manifold copper pipes should be used to the appliances.

      No need for PVC covered pipe, although this helps battle corrosion for pipes on the outside of the van floor.

  10. insurance
    can anyone tell me where i can get reasonable insurance im about to purchase a van to convert to a camper but am quoted vast amounts for insurance the quotes iv got for the van once done are a quarter the price of pre conversion. is there a policy or way round this whilst the conversion takes place?

    Reply

    1. Several companies offer a
      Several companies offer a policy that gives you 90 days (and normally a bit more) to do the conversion. They insure you throughout.
